What is Azenta EV-to-FCF?

Azenta AZTA -2.34% 70 EV-to-FCF is 29.52 as of Jul. 14, 2026, which is 2% below its 10-year median of 30.26. GuruFocus rates AZTA with a GF Score™ of 70/100 and a GF Value™ of $63.42 (Possible Value Trap). The stock has 2 warning signs investors should review. Among 414 Medical Devices & Instruments companies, Azenta ranks worse than 61.59% on this metric.

EV-to-FCF is calculated as enterprise value divided by its free cash flow. As of today, Azenta's Enterprise Value is $847.8 Mil. Azenta's Free Cash Flow for the trailing twelve months (TTM) ended in Mar. 2026 was $28.7 Mil. Therefore, Azenta's EV-to-FCF for today is 29.52.

Azenta EV-to-FCF Calculation

Azenta's EV-to-FCF for today is calculated as:

EV-to-FCF=Enterprise Value (Today)/Free Cash Flow (TTM)
=847.795/28.717
=29.52

Azenta's current Enterprise Value is $847.8 Mil.
Azenta's Free Cash Flow for the trailing twelve months (TTM) ended in Mar. 2026 adds up the quarterly data reported by the company within the most recent 12 months, which was $28.7 Mil.

Azenta Business Description

Other Exchanges 0HQ1:UKBA3:Germany
Address 200 Summit Drive, 6th Floor, Burlington, MA, USA, 01803
Azenta Inc provides biological and chemical sample exploration and management solutions, using precision automation and cryogenics to develop automated ultra-cold storage. It serves customers from research to commercialization with sample management, automated storage, genomic services, consumables, informatics, and repository services. The company operates through two segments: Sample Management Solutions, offering SRS and Core Products such as automated stores, cryogenic systems, sample tubes, consumables, instruments, and thawing devices, which generate majority of its revenue; and Multiomics, which provides genomic analysis services. The company operates in United States, China, United Kingdom, rest of Europe, and others, with majority of its revenue in the United States.
